Location, Location, Location

     In 1971, Dr. Landmesser rescued four houses on the Spa Creek end of Shaw St. in Murray Hill, ingeniously envisioning creating an intimate new community near Truxtun Park.
    The ingenuity came in when the houses were moved by barge across Spa Creek to a lovely track of old farm land that was home to a beautiful brick early 18th c. manor, preserved and privately owned, with gardens and orchard surround. The Shaw St. house that had been Judge Michaelson’s family home never made it to the new site. It slipped off the barge and fell in, making front page big news of the day in The Evening Capitol.
    The remaining houses made a new village on Milkshake Lane, with the manor house centerpiece. Later, Dr. Landmesser built a very interesting post and beam home for himself, part of the new community. This property is close to all the amenities of Truxtun Park, docks, playgrounds, running, walking and nature trails. Tennis and swimming too! City bus service to downtown. Close to Aris T Allen Blvd, connecting to Baltimore and Washington commutes. Quite a nice little spot!
    The house at 6 Milkshake Lane is cottage perfect with old plaster walls, gleaming wood floors, oak on the first level and pine on the second. The attractive new kitchen has work island, wood cabinets and floor, nicely 
appointed with recent stainless appliances, gas cooking. Adjoining is a versatile room for family/dining- buyer choice.
    There is a foyer entrance to a large living room with wood burning fireplace. Off living room, a cheerful den. Large powder room. 
   The second level has a wonderful master bedroom, cedar lined closet, with new bath en suite. Two other bedrooms and recent bath complete the picture.
   The third level offers a large space for home office, playroom, and exercise area.
   The big surprise is the lower level with a nice kitchen and two rooms and bath. Storage and utility areas are separate.
   New gas boiler, gas hot heater, all new double pane windows, new gutters and downspouts, old slate roof, lots of closet. All mechanicals updated. Original wood shingle exterior.
   The garden has a shed, dollhouse, and various fun things for kids that convey with purchase. Big shade trees.         Milkshake Lane is a pleasant allée of trees and flowering shrubbery, a place truly apart in the downtown Annapolis scene.
